Well I dont have little kids anymore, however we did have grandkids who were close to 2 and 5 and they went to the Butterfly farm at st. Maartin and loved it. The youngest got a little scared because there were butterflies landing on him, but once he found out they wouldnt hurt him it was ok.
St. Thomas we kept the kids and took them on an island tour, which was boring for them, but fun for us. Not much accept beaches there for little ones. I know my other grandkids took the lift (tram) up the side of the mountain for the view and there was a bird show there to see.
I have never been there yet, but Coral World might work for young kids. It is like an underwater observatory where you can go and see the fish in their natural habitat without getting wet yourself. maybe someone else here has done it and could give you details about it.
